As we’re now just days from a brand new NHL season, everyone seems to have an opinion about Connor Bedard. The young prospect is the most hyped-up first-overall pick in the NHL in many years, and it’s not for nothing.

Bedard had a record-breaking season in the WHL last year, and he was a superstar for Team Canada in the WJC. Bedard was selected by the Chicago Blackhawks, and the organization and city couldn’t been happier.

Chicago Blackhawks ticket sales have rushed through the roof since they won the lottery, and although many predict the Blackhawks will miss the playoffs this year, everyone’s excited about how Bedard adapts to the big league.

But Bedard’s pre-season display hasn’t been perfect. He’s only scored one goal—an empty-netter against the Red Wings—and many believe the expectations on the young prospects are set too high and unreasonable.

But some think he’s ready to make an immigrant impact, and not only that. Some experts and former players already think he’s one of the best in the league. When TSN placed Bedard 48th in their annual top 50 players in the NHL, it drew ire from fans, thinking they put him way too high, especially since he hasn’t actually played a single game in the league yet.

But former NHLer P.K. Subban thinks even higher of Bedard, and his bold take now has fans talking. According to Subban, Bedard is already one of the best players in the league, and he seems absolutely sure that the 18-year-old will be a superstar in the big league.

”1. If you think this kid isn’t going to be a superstar you are nuts!” He said on his Instagram.

”2. If you think he’s overhyped…get checked!” He continues.
To finish his bold take, Subban said:

”3. If you don’t think he is already in the top 10 players in the league right now in terms of skill…You don’t get a seat at my table! Period.
I don’t want to hear it!!!!”

Fans didn’t precisely universally approve of Subban’s statement, as many snapped back at him.

”I’ll believe it when he scores not empty net goals,” one responded on his Instagram.
